## Overview

OpenAI announced a custom AI chip codenamed 'Jalapeño', positioning it as a faster, cheaper alternative to Nvidia's Blackwell architecture, signaling a strategic shift toward vertical integration in AI hardware.

### TL;DR

- OpenAI unveiled its first custom AI chip, Jalapeño, targeting performance and cost advantages over Nvidia.
- The announcement coincides with broader industry movement toward custom silicon for AI inference and training.
- No technical specifications, benchmarks, fabrication partner, timeline, or production status were disclosed in the source material.

## Narrative Mechanics

**Function:** manufacture_urgency  

### The Spin in Plain English

The story presents an unproven chip as if it’s already reshaping market dynamics — using competitive language like 'threat' and 'gains ground' to imply momentum and inevitability, even though no working hardware or data exists yet.

**What the story wants you to believe:** That OpenAI has achieved a critical milestone in hardware independence, making its AI stack more competitive and less vulnerable to Nvidia’s pricing and supply constraints.  

**What it makes harder to question:** Whether OpenAI has the expertise, capital, or time-to-market capability to execute a custom chip program — especially one that must compete with decades of Nvidia’s engineering advantage.  

**How the Spin Works:** The story creates time pressure — limited windows, competitive races, or imminent shifts — to push readers toward acceptance before scrutiny. Watch for loaded terms such as threat, gains ground, faster, cheaper, better than. The distribution reads as wire reprint. A pressure point: No disclosure of design stage (RTL, tape-out, silicon), no power or thermal constraints, no software stack compatibility, no yield or scalability data.

## Reader Risk

**Evidence Strength:** unverified  
The source provides no technical documentation, benchmarks, images, quotes from engineers, or independent confirmation — only headline-style assertions and comparative claims.  
**Verification Status:** Unclear / Unverified  
**Narrative Risk:** moderate  
If Jalapeño fails to deliver functional silicon within 12–18 months, or if early benchmarks underperform, the narrative could backfire as overpromising — especially given OpenAI’s prior lack of hardware execution history.  
**AI Repetition Risk:** high  
**What AI Will Probably Repeat:** OpenAI has developed the Jalapeño AI chip, which is faster and cheaper than Nvidia’s Blackwell architecture.  
AI systems will likely drop all qualifiers — omitting that this is an unverified, pre-silicon announcement with no public evidence — and present it as a deployed, benchmarked product.  
**Counter-Frame (Media):** Media may reframe as 'PR stunt' or 'speculative vaporware' once timelines slip or technical gaps emerge.  
**Missing Voices:** OpenAI hardware engineers, Nvidia technical response, Semiconductor analysts with foundry access, Independent silicon verification labs  

### Questions Not Answered

- Is Jalapeño taped out, fabricated, or functional?
- Which process node and foundry are used?
- What workloads does it accelerate — training, inference, or both?
- What is OpenAI’s production volume target or deployment timeline?
- Has any third party validated its claimed performance or cost advantages?
